Output 12eb288b4e03422dfd577bbf426b41b4db74d5102bced5e2c22113b489046249:0

value
99314186
script pubkey
OP_0 OP_PUSHBYTES_20 af7befd52a63d724eda199c09d43fecd076c6c0a
address
bc1q4aa7l4f2v0tjfmdpn8qf6sl7e5rkcmq2m8ty74
transaction
12eb288b4e03422dfd577bbf426b41b4db74d5102bced5e2c22113b489046249
confirmations
346273
spent
true